No. Qonterra is priced on seats and feature tier, not per project. Customers can run as many projects, scenarios, and portfolio analyses as their workflow requires. This is intentional: per-project pricing creates incentive friction against running the additional scenarios that actually improve decisions.
Standard contracts are annual, paid quarterly or annually. Enterprise customers can negotiate multi-year contracts with corresponding discounts. Payment is invoice-based in all major currencies. All plans include a 60-day implementation period before billing begins, to allow time for configuration and onboarding.
Annual contracts can be canceled at the end of any contract term with 60 days' notice. Mid-term cancellations are not standard, but exceptions are made for cause. All customer data is exportable in standard formats (Excel, CSV, JSON) at any time, with no exit fees.
